Storing and Freshness Tips for String Cheese and Fruit Packs

To keep your string cheese and fruit packs fresh and tasty, proper storage is key. Store string cheese in the original packaging or an airtight container in the refrigerator at or below 40°F (4°C). This helps prevent spoilage and maintains its chewy texture.

Fruits should be kept in a breathable container or a sealed plastic bag lined with a paper towel. This absorbs excess moisture, which can cause spoilage. Fresh fruits like berries and sliced apples are best enjoyed within a few days for optimal freshness when stored properly.

For convenience, pre-assembled snack packs can be kept in the fridge until you’re ready to grab them. If packing for on-the-go, consider packing string cheese separately from fruits to prevent sogginess or spoilage. Using small, airtight containers ensures your snack packs stay fresh longer.

Fruit Variety Options for Sensitive Stomachs

For those with sensitive stomachs, choosing gentle, easily digestible fruits is key when creating string cheese and fruit packs. Opting for low-acid options like bananas, melons, or canned peaches can minimize discomfort, making snacks more enjoyable and tummy-friendly.

Fruits such as ripe bananas and cantaloupe are naturally soft and gentle, reducing the risk of irritation. These options also provide essential nutrients without triggering common sensitivities or acid reflux. If fresh fruits are harsh on digestion, canned or cooked versions can be a good alternative.

It’s wise to avoid high-acid fruits like citrus, pineapple, or tomatoes if you have a sensitive stomach, as they might cause heartburn or bloating. Always observe how your body responds to different fruits, and consider introducing new ones gradually.

Choosing lactose-free string cheese can also complement sensitive stomach-friendly fruit options. Overall, selecting mild, familiar fruits ensures your healthy snack ideas remain comfortable and satisfying for everyone’s digestion.

Choosing Lactose-Free String Cheese Alternatives

When selecting lactose-free string cheese alternatives, it’s important to look for options that mimic the texture and flavor of traditional cheese while being suitable for those with lactose intolerance. Many brands now offer plant-based or dairy-free versions that use ingredients such as soy, cashews, or coconut oil. These alternatives often have a creamy, stringy consistency similar to regular string cheese, making them a popular choice for healthy snack packs.

Reading labels carefully can help you find options with minimal additives or artificial ingredients. Some lactose-free string cheese products are fortified with calcium and vitamins, providing nutritional benefits comparable to traditional cheese. If you’re sensitive to certain ingredients, checking for allergen information allows you to choose the best fit for your dietary needs.

There are also lactase-enzyme supplements available that help digest lactose, which can be an alternative if you’re not strictly avoiding dairy but want to reduce discomfort. Overall, exploring lactose-free string cheese alternatives ensures you can enjoy delicious, nutritious, and satisfying snacks on your healthy journey without compromising your dietary restrictions.
